Kloe FroebeLincoln West Lincoln-Broadwell![]() Principal: Ms. Heather Baker Kloe Froebe excels both in and out of the classroom. She is the Scholar Attitude Award winner for Board of Directors Division I.Kloe has maintained a 4.0 grade point average while competing in three sports: basketball, volleyball and track and field and serving as a captain. The ability to excel at all these, while still being involved in her community, is Kloe's proudest achievement. "This accomplishment has made me learn to prioritize my education, sports, and activities to be the best that I can be in all areas." Participating in interscholastic activities, which also includes Beta Club, Student Council and Service Club, has taught Kloe several important life skills. She says these include greater confidence, setting high expectations for herself, and the opportunity to be a role model for younger student-athletes. Her involvement in interscholastic activities also helped Kloe through a rough time when her best friend since kindergarten moved out of state. "For a while, I thought school would never be the same without her, and the fear of making new friends was overwhelming," Kloe says. "Being part of the basketball, volleyball and track teams allowed me to connect with other girls in my class as well as classes above me. Those relationships helped to guide me through a very difficult time of losing my best friend." After high school Kloe plans to attend college. She enjoys learning Spanish and can picture herself in a law career utilizing the Spanish language. She also hopes to continue playing basketball at the collegiate level. |
